I have already extracted seeds from 5-6 berries and placed on a tile
Remove pulp from seeds
Its been 2 days seeds have dried up perfectly...now we will extract the seeds from the tile.
sprinkle/place 2-3 seeds in each hole for better germination rate
Gently cover all the holes with coco peat
I have got approximately 95% germination rate
Use containers that are large enough with proper drainage
Gently pull one plant out and place it in the hole
Remove all the air gaps by pushing the soil down
Keep the new plant in a place with low levels of light for a few days. It will take a day or 2 for the plant to adjust to its new soil environment, and only then should you bring it back into a full-light environment
